Pizza Rolls

Homemade Pizza Rolls Your Family Will Devour and Love

These Homemade Pizza Rolls are a delicious snack, perfect for busy days and gatherings, customizable to cater to every craving.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Rising Time 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 55 minutes
Servings: 12 rolls
Course: Lunch
Cuisine: Italian
Calories: 200

Ingredients
  

For the Dough
  • 2.5 cups All-purpose flour Can substitute with whole wheat flour.
  • 1 teaspoon Salt Enhances flavor; essential for dough.
  • 1 tablespoon Sugar Can use honey or agave syrup instead.
  • 2 teaspoons Active dry yeast Instant yeast can be used, reducing activation time.
  • 1 cup Warm water (110°F) Activates the yeast.
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il Can substitute with melted butter.
For the Filling
  • 1 cup Pizza sauce Alternative sauces like marinara or pesto can work.
  • 2 cups Shredded mozzarella cheese Substitute with provolone or cheddar.
  • 1 cup Chopped pepperoni (optional) Can include sausage, ham, or vegetables.
  • 1 cup Sautéed vegetables (optional) Use bell peppers, onions, or mushrooms.
For Finishing Touches
  • 1 Egg (for egg wash) Omit for a vegan version.
  • 2 tablespoons Melted butter (optional for brushing)

Equipment

  • mixing bowl
  • baking sheet
  • Knife
  • Roller

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ions for Homemade Pizza Rolls
  1. Prepare Yeast Mixture: Combine warm water, sugar, and yeast. Let sit for 5-10 minutes until frothy.
  2. Make Dough: Whisk flour and salt, add yeast mixture and olive oil. Knead for 5 minutes.
  3. Let Rise: Grease a bowl, place dough inside, cover, and let rise for about 1 hour.
  4. Shape Rolls: Roll out dough, spread pizza sauce, cheese, and toppings. Roll tightly.
  5. Cut and Prepare: Slice dough into 1-inch sections, place on greased sheet, brush tops with egg wash.
  6. Bake: Preheat oven to 375°F. Bake for 20-25 minutes until golden brown.
  7. Cool and Serve: Let cool for 5 minutes, serve warm with extra pizza sauce.

Notes

Perfect for meal prep and can be frozen for later. Ensure the filling is dry to avoid soggy rolls.
